Shake-up in Nigerian police force as PSC redeploys officers

The Police Service Commission (PSC) on Wednesday confirmed the redeployment of four Commissioners of Police to various State Commands across Nigeria

 

CP Abaniwonda Olufemi, previously deployed to Rivers State, will now serve as Commissioner of Police in Delta State.

CP Peter Ukachi Opara, initially appointed to the Federal Capital Territory (FCT) and then Delta State, has been redeployed to lead the Cross River State Command.

 

Additionally, CP Mustapha Mohammed Bala from Katsina State has been assigned to Rivers State Command, while CP Gyogon Augustine Grimah from Nasarawa State will take over leadership in Kaduna State.

 

The PSC has officially notified the Inspector-General of Police regarding these new postings.
